WebMar 23, 2024 · Tiered pricing is a pricing strategy that scales the price of a product according different thresholds of a certain metric. For example, a B2B SaaS company may have an entry-level tier that allows one employee to access the system and a higher-end tier that lets unlimited employees use it. WebNov 20, 2024 · In our example, this business card size ad in our diagram is 3 columns by 2 inches (6 total column inches). If the newspaper's columns measure 1.375 inches then we can assume this ad is 3.375 inches wide by 2 inches deep.
